F100 stalling when hot

i have replaced the entire fuel delivery tank to carb, new wires new voltage regulator new gas. Timing is correct, etc. I can start it and run it for about 30 minutes, and then it stalls like it’s running out of fuel. Let it rest and it starts up. Air temps are around 75 degrees and I’m not driving in traffic. Pretty much driving it in circles on my property to try and see why this is happening. Vapor lock? My thought is that it’s really not that hot and the truck is moving when it stalls. Any help would be appreciated or I might have a f100 for sale

I have been struggling with the same issue.... Vapor lock has been the diagnosis.

I have replaced everything from the tank forward and still have the issue. I can see the fuel vaporizing in the clear filter between the fuel pump and carb.

I have a 351m and have noticed with headers the steel fuel line runs close to the aftermarket header. I will reroute when time permits.

Tank vent? If your tank or gas cap isn't vented properly, the pump will create a vacuum on the tank. I fought that for a while. It was wearing out fuel pumps. Someone on here asked me if I had a vented cap, and my answer was yes. But it wasn't vented enough I guess. I drilled a small hole at an angle in the cap. I just make sure the hole is pointed down. I haven't been able to find a better cap. I've got an aftermarket, non emissions type fuel tank, so I don't have an outlet to run a vent.

A few ways to check: Install a clear fuel filter just before the carburetor. When at idle and things are normal, the filter should be full of fuel and even though it's flowing, you can't tell. If it's partially full and bubbling, there's an issue. Could be fuel pump, tank not venting, clogged filter, etc. If you observe the filter is half full and bubbling, try removing the fuel tank cap and then watch the filter. If it fills up, then it's probably poorly vented tank.

Do you have the resistance wire on the coil? If you don't the coil tends to overheat and cause a no spark condition.

What distrubutor do you have? Points or electronic pick up?

Maybe a different angle of looking at it from a spark perspective.

I had a 302 in the past with an electronic pick up in the distributor.. when the engine would warm up (After about 30 mins or so), the electronic pick up would no longer work, the engine would shut off and i would have to wait for the engine to cool off for a while and then it would start again. Replaced the pick up and never had the issue again.

Fixed! I think

I vented the gas cap it was the original one, have it running continually for 40 minute now. I think that was the problem Thank you all for your advise
